Responsibilities
Responsible for day‑to‑day operations of the infection prevention function at local entities and applicable practices.
Responsible for leading and driving safety and quality performance improvement initiatives to address trends and deficiencies in Infection Prevention as identified by the Surveillance and Analysis team and set by PHC QSS.
Promotes a culture of continuous improvement in the reduction of infections through use of Lean methodology, coaching, tools, data analysis, reliability, sustainability and spread.
Manages and supports a portfolio of strategic projects using the performance improvement model.
Ensures all performance improvement activities are compliant with regulatory and accreditation bodies.
Qualifications
Bachelor's Degree in Nursing with a current license in the State of Georgia as a Registered Nurse or NLC/eNLC Multistate License OR Master’s in Microbiology, Public Health, Biology, Epidemiology, Medical Technology or another related health/science field – Required
Work Experience
5 years of previous work experience in a hospital setting, clinical quality, epidemiology or performance improvement, preferably in infection prevention – Required
Licenses and Certifications
None Required
Additional Licenses and Certifications
Current Certification in Infection Control (CIC) from the Certification Board of Infection Control and Epidemiology (CBIC) – Required
